P0305

Cylinder 5 Misfire Detected

P0305 is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Cylinder 5 Misfire Detected. Common causes: faulty spark plugs, problems with the ignition coil. Estimated repair cost: $56–222.

Severity
⚠️ Medium
Can you drive?
Limited driving only, diagnose soon
Approx. repair cost
$56–222 (est.)

Symptoms

  • The engine hesitates or runs rough
  • Power Loss
  • Increased fuel consumption
  • Engine vibration
  • Check Engine Light Is On

Causes

  • Faulty spark plugs
  • Problems with the ignition coil
  • Dirty or faulty fuel injectors
  • Low cylinder compression
  • Damaged valves or piston rings
  • Problems with the air intake system

How to Fix

  1. Check the spark plugs and replace if necessary
  2. Check the ignition coil and high voltage wires
  3. Diagnose fuel injectors
  4. Check cylinder compression
  5. Inspect valves and piston rings
